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Microsoft Sentinel
- Billing is driven by the volume of log data ingested per day, so cost scales with log noise rather than with users or protected assets
- Commitment tier discounts require reserving daily ingestion capacity in advance, and a tier cannot be downgraded until 31 days have passed
- Commitment tiers start at 100 GB per day, above what smaller estates ingest
- Charges for Log Analytics, Logic Apps and Machine Learning are billed separately on top of Sentinel itself
- The free allowance is only up to 5 MB per user per day for selected Microsoft 365 security logs
- Promotional commitment pricing is time limited and locks in only until a stated end date
Vanta
- No published pricing for any tier; all plans require requesting a demo and contacting sales
- Essentials tier limited to one compliance framework; organisations needing multiple frameworks must upgrade to higher tiers
- Plus and Professional tiers feature unclear differentiation; specific pricing and included questionnaires not published
- Enterprise pricing fully custom; no transparency on costs or what features are included
- AI questionnaire automation capped at 25 annually in Plus tier, only 144 annually in Professional tier

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Microsoft Sentinel: How is Microsoft Sentinel pricing calculated?
Microsoft Sentinel uses a pay-as-you-go usage-based model where you pay only for data ingested, stored, and consumed. Flexible commitment tiers are available to reduce total cost of ownership, with specific rates not published on the public pricing page. SourceVanta: How many compliance frameworks does Vanta support?
Vanta supports 35+ compliance frameworks including SOC 2, ISO 27001, HIPAA, GDPR and custom frameworks.
SourceMicrosoft Sentinel: Does Microsoft Sentinel require an Azure subscription?
Yes, Microsoft Sentinel requires a Microsoft Azure subscription to operate. Pricing is handled through Azure and varies based on data consumption and the commitment tier you select. Source: https://www.microsoft.com/security/business/siem-and-xdr/microsoft-sentinel/
SourceVanta: Does Vanta automate questionnaires?
Yes. Vanta's AI Agent can automate questionnaire completion, with the number of annually supported questionnaires varying by plan (25 in Plus tier, 144 in Professional tier).
SourceVanta: How many integrations does Vanta support?
Vanta integrates with 300+ pre-built system connections and supports over 90% automation of compliance tasks through these integrations.
